Marine operations halted due to weather
30 Mar 2026, Ras Al Khaimah, United Arab Emirates
Due to adverse weather/sea conditions, marine operations were suspended at 19:00 on 28 March at RAK Maritime City/Stevin Rock Harbour/Saqr Port.
Tropical Cyclone Narelle: Port Impact Update
30 Mar 2026, West Australia/Pilbara, Australia
The cyclone phase is now over and Narelle has been downgraded to tropical low, however operations are constrained due to infrastructure damage and readiness.
